A Certified Professional in Semiconductor Device Fabrication Processes certification equips individuals with the essential skills and knowledge needed to excel in the semiconductor industry. The program's curriculum focuses on hands-on training and theoretical understanding, covering cleanroom techniques, process integration, and quality control.
Learning outcomes for this certification typically include mastery of photolithography, etching, deposition, and ion implantation techniques, all crucial steps in semiconductor device fabrication. Graduates gain a comprehensive understanding of process control, metrology, and failure analysis, enhancing their problem-solving abilities within a semiconductor manufacturing environment. Advanced topics such as thin-film technologies and device characterization may also be included, depending on the specific program.
The duration of a Certified Professional in Semiconductor Device Fabrication Processes program varies depending on the institution and the intensity of the course. Generally, expect a program length ranging from several months to a year, with a combination of classroom instruction, laboratory work, and potentially internships or capstone projects. Successful completion typically involves passing a comprehensive examination demonstrating competency in microfabrication and semiconductor manufacturing.
